Pineapple Sativa is very popular with both (medicinal) smokers and growers and is famous for its reliable and high yields of quality cannabis.
The fruity Pineapple Sativa is a cross between Blue Dream and White Widow. As you might have guessed from its name, the Pineapple Sativa is mainly Sativa. The composition is 80% Sativa and 20% Indica.
Thanks to the popular White Widow, the Pineapple Sativa will give you a high yield and an easy to grow plant. When looked after properly, the yield can be incredible. The plant gets pretty large, with long, thin leafs and compact buds. So make sure you have enough space, so it can grow to its leisure. The blueberry effects from the Blue Dream can cause some nice colours in its tips. The blooming period of the Pineapple Sativa is 9 to 10 weeks and it can be grown both indoors and outdoors, but it will grow much better indoors.
Pineapple Sativa is famous for its oldschool haze flavour, which combined with the White Widow effect, makes sure to cheer you up and keep you clear. The oldschool haze taste of the Pineapple Sativa is surprising and besides that it doesn’t just taste sweet, but also nice and fruity and refreshing. The effects are long lasting. Pineapple Sativa offers the best of both; a relaxing stone in combination with a pleasant energetic high. Medically the Pineapple Sativa will help to reduce nausea, pain and stress.
Unique traits
- Tall plant with a very good yield
- Long lasting effects
- Energetic high
- THC 18%
- CBD Average
- Yield when grown indoors 500 – 650 grams per m2
- Yield when grown outdoors 650 – 750 grams per dried plant
- Height when grown indoors 90 – 130 cm
- Height when grown outdoors 120 – 170 cm
- Blooms 9 - 10 weeks
- Harvest October
- Genetic background Blue Dream X White Widow
- Sativa - Indica 80% Sativa 20% Indica
